Shadow map bias cone and improved soft shadows: Disney bonus section

Published: 30 July 2006 Publication History

Abstract

A new shadow map sampling method using a "bias cone" is described that has fewer artifacts than sampling using a constant bias and it is shown how to apply this sampling to the generation of perceptually accurate soft shadows from a single shadow map.
